eight. Lorazepam (Ativan) Employed in dogs for: situational anxiety, phobias, fear anxiety, stress Conditions Lorazepam is a brief-acting medication that requires result in about 30 minutes. Each time possible lorazepam ought to be offered to dogs in advance of the occasion that is thought to trigger anxiety. The drug can even be presented at the earliest sign that a Puppy is starting to become nervous. This medication shouldn't be stopped abruptly For those who have been giving it on your Pet dog lengthy-phrase. This medication is classed as being a benzodiazepine and will work by selling g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) exercise while in the Mind. GABA inhibits the effects of excitatory nerve indicators within the Mind, leading to a calming impact on your pet. Probable Unintended effects might contain: Grogginess Sedation Lack of harmony Elevated hunger Excitement Aggressive habits 9. Paroxetine (Paxil) Used in dogs for: generalized anxiety, nervous aggression and anxiety-connected behaviors, concern of noises Paroxetine is usually a member in the selective serotonin-re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) course of medications, which prevent receptors within the Mind from eradicating the nervous system chemical messenger serotonin. This allows for bigger serotonin stages inside the Mind. Paroxetine may take four to six months to choose impact and should be presented once day-to-day.

Currently Clomicalm, Reconcile, and Sileo are the only FDA-accredited medications to be used in dogs. One other obtainable prescription drugs that your vet might advise on your Doggy’s anxiety are all human prescription drugs, used off-label in dogs. The phrase off-label or additional-label use ensures that a medication can be employed in a method or in a certain species that aren't specified over the medication label. Off- or more-label use of a medication can only be carried out by a veterinarian that has immediate and personal expertise in your Puppy and when there are no other acceptable prescription drugs for a certain dog's instances. These drugs may not be offered in the appropriate dosage power for dogs , so they may have to be compounded by a specialty pharmacy right into a flavored chewable tablet, capsule, liquid, or transdermal medication. Compounded medications will also be ideal for dogs who don’t delight in getting capsules and want a unique formulation in their medication. Alprazolam (Xanax) Utilized in dogs for: phobias, panic, worry visit this site right here Issues Alprazolam is commonly prescribed that can help dogs who come to be nervous during thunderstorms, but it surely can also be used for other kinds of situational anxiety for example highway journeys and vet Business visits. Alprazolam is usually a member of your benzodiazepine course of sedatives, which do the job by depressing activity in particular areas of the central nervous system.

3. Buspirone Utilized in dogs for: phobias, generalized anxiety Buspirone can be a member of your azapirone class of anxiety-lowering drugs. This medication necessitates continued use to be successful, so it’s not helpful for dogs that experience situational anxieties like thunderstorm phobias.
